1. Capacity expansion depends on the adding method. From the attributes, we can see that there is a DEFAULT_CAPACITY attribute value of 10.
public boolean add(E e) { // 验证是否需要扩容操作 ensureCapacityInternal(size + 1); // Increments modCount!! // 在对应的下标下添加值 elementData[size++] = e; return true; }
2. Just entered ensureCapacityInternal(size 1) size is a complete variable.
marks the size of the ArrayList (the number of elements it contains), and the one with no elements at this time is ensureCapacityInternal(0 1).
//1、进入这个方法 private void ensureCapacityInternal(int minCapacity) { //2、先调用calculateCapacity(elementData, minCapacity)、这个方法就是检查第一次添加数据、并返回默认的容器大小(就是10) // 4、就是执行这个方法ensureExplicitCapacity(10) // 为什么参数是10、就是因为这个方法calculateCapacity(elementData, minCapacity)做了操作。 ensureExplicitCapacity(calculateCapacity(elementData, minCapacity)); } //3、数组容量计算 private static int calculateCapacity(Object[] elementData, int minCapacity) { // 这个能处理就是第一次添加数据时为真 if (elementData == DEFAULTCAPACITY_EMPTY_ELEMENTDATA) { // 然后这个成立、这个方法是取参数1和参数2、两个数之间的值 // DEFAULT_CAPACITY : 默认为10 // minCapacity : 第一次添加数据为1 // 所以10 和 1 、10大、最后将10返回出去 return Math.max(DEFAULT_CAPACITY, minCapacity); } return minCapacity; } //5、确保显式容量 private void ensureExplicitCapacity(int minCapacity) { modCount++; // 6、做判断、 // 第一次添加数据时 为 10-0 > 0 :第一次可以成立 // 第二次添加数据时 为 2-10 > 0 :第二次可以不成立 if (minCapacity - elementData.length > 0) //7、执行下面方法、这个方法的作用才是正真的实施扩容并确定首次扩容ArrayList容器大小的方法 grow(minCapacity);//扩容 }

The core components of the JVM include ClassLoader, RuntimeDataArea and ExecutionEngine. 1) ClassLoader is responsible for loading, linking and initializing classes and interfaces. 2) RuntimeDataArea contains MethodArea, Heap, Stack, PCRegister and NativeMethodStacks. 3) ExecutionEngine is composed of Interpreter, JITCompiler and GarbageCollector, responsible for the execution and optimization of bytecode.
